All Aboard the Nautical Revival in Gucci Menswear Spring/Summer 2015 Collection

26 June 2014

By Peter Yeap

The nautical theme saw a revival in Gucci’s menswear collection for the Spring/Summer 2015 season, offering a twist yet embracing the enduring sophistication of the classic look.

This approach follows on from the themed floral and sportswear hybrid for Spring/Summer 2014, and Fall/Winter 2014/2015's which featured 1960s style.

It was back in the 19th century when Queen Elizabeth dressed her four year old son, Albert Edward, in a sailor suit to wear aboard the Royal Yacht. The seafaring stripes have since then become a must-have pattern upon neck-to-knee swimwear.
The fashion then immersed itself into Hollywood movies and soon after transferred from swimwear into casual clothing.

Up first was the Gucci man with his rock ‘n roll free spirit and affection for jet-setting and devotion for noble sporting, adorning a slim cut white suit with two navy bands of piping at the sleeves (denoting rank insignias), alongside slender shaped trousers, and later in red and teal green versions, showcase a slim urban silhouette fit for the sartorial naval captain.

Navy blazers with styling variations from the peacoat to the mackintosh, were Gucci’s sophisticated take on sea-borne tailoring classics - perfect for a weekend sojourn at the yacht club. Gold buttons further embellish the accompanying dockside ankle-length pants, whilst stone-washed jeans with paint splashes look appropriate for the deckhand.

Ribbed knitwear - a luxurious version of the fisherman’s pullover - and suits were given an ostentatious new-fangled Gucci crest.

The nautical theme, with reminiscent pirate stripes, paired well with a minimalist palette of designs in navy blue, blue-black, khaki, white, red, and emerald green. There was even an untucked, striped pajama top making an appearance amongst the chic three-piece suits.

Ultra luxurious travel and messenger bags in calfskin, crocodile or canvas with maxi monochrome or striped cross-body straps, brought out the collection’s relaxed sophistication - with duffel bags perfect for the getaway during the summer season.

Striped foulards of knotted metal bracelets - a highlight in Gucci's new menswear accessories - along with beaded necklaces are set to bring out the bohemian instincts for the summer.

For evening wear, black lines were adopted to border the edge of while dinner jacket and shot down the sides of pants to deliver a bit of consistency to the formal wear.
